College softball: Bates' Pelletier named NESCAC Pitcher of the Week
HADLEY, Mass. — For the second time this season, Bates College sophomore pitcher Kirsten Pelletier was named the NESCAC Pitcher of the Week. Pelletier, of Sidney, tossed her second no-hitter of the season in a 10-0 win over Colby on Friday. She struck out 10 in that five-inning game. The next day, she shut down […]

College roundup: Bates softball sweeps Colby
WATERVILLE — After clinching a spot in the NESCAC tournament on Friday, the Bates softball team broke the program record for wins in a season with a doubleheader sweep of Colby on Saturday, taking game one 11-3 and blanking the Mules 1-0 in game two. Pelletier no hits Colby as Bates softball clinches a playoff spot in the NESCAC Tournament
LEWISTON — Kirsten Pelletier threw her second no-hitter of the season as the Bates defeated Colby 8-0 in five innings on Friday, clinching a spot in the eight-team NESCAC Softball Championship tournament.
